Draft texts, [1945-1949], relating to the Cold War

Manuscript drafts and other papers relating to the Cold War, including: draft chapters and synopsis of a book by Tom Wintringham, A Split World, on the world divided between USA, USSR and Britain; draft chapters and synopsis of a book by Wintringham Govern the World! on the possibility of a world government; typescript 'manifesto for a world truce'; press cuttings, including 'The challenge of the atom bomb', in the Nation, 22 Dec 1945; 'Ersatz orchids for UNO', in the Nation, 16 Mar 1946; 'The world comes of age', in the Nation, 20 Apr 1946; 'We talk with Stalin on the two roads to socialism', in the Daily Herald, 22 Aug 1946; 'Striking the balance', in the Listener, 17 Oct 1946; 'How to understand the Russians', in British Survey, 6 Nov 1946; 'The individual and the mass', in the Picture Post, 7 Dec 1946; the New Statesman and Nation, 5 Jul 1947; 'Changing moods in Russia', in the Listener, 17 Jul 1947; Soviet News 30 May 1946, 9 May 1947, 14 May 1947 and 8 Jul 1947; 'Why not a world truce?', 2 Oct 1948 and 'World war against hunger', 27 Nov 1948. 1 file

Draft text of an unpublished work by Tom Wintringham, 'We're going on: a personal record of war in Spain and Catalonia', 1936-1937

Typescript and manuscript drafts and typescript synopsis, 11 Nov 1936, of unpublished account by Tom Wintringham entitled We're Going On: a personal record of war in Spain and Catalonia , relating to Wintringham's early experiences in the British Bn, International Brigade in the Spanish Civil War. 1 file
